BORDENTOWN CITY – This year a special award will be given out in honor of the past chairman of the Bordentown City Halloween parade. The Steve McGowan Award will be given to the float or marching unit that best shows community and Halloween spirit.
In keeping with Mr. McGowan’s philosophy, this float or marching unit doesn’t have to be anything elaborate.
Various other awards are given out after the parade for several child, adult, and business categories.
Floats and marching units are needed for the upcoming Halloween Parade, Sunday, Oct. 24, at 2 p.m. Those already registered include Bordentown Home for Funerals which sponsors the local area Girl Scouts, Mom’s Club of Florence, Chesterfield Veterinary, Hamilton PAL Twirlers, and PNC Bank. Children, adults, groups and families that would like to be judged as masquerades before the parade, should report to the parking lot at St. Mary School at 1:15 p.m. Judging will begin promptly at 1:30. Register at the table in front of St. Mary’s School to participate in the costume contest on the day of the parade.
